Approximately 80% of individuals with ADHD experience sleep difficulties, often exacerbated by perimenopause, creating a vicious cycle where disrupted sleep worsens ADHD symptoms.
ADHD brains frequently exhibit a delayed circadian rhythm, making them natural night owls and leading to perpetual tiredness in a society structured for early risers.
Practical solutions include using amber-lensed glasses and ensuring a completely dark bedroom (test by holding hand at arm's length) to help regulate light exposure and advance the circadian rhythm.
Cognitive Behavioral Therapy for Insomnia (CBT-I) is the primary recommended treatment, focusing on cognitive restructuring to challenge negative beliefs about sleep.
The "20-20 rule" advises getting out of bed for 20 minutes if awake for more than 20 minutes, engaging in a boring, non-stimulating activity (like folding laundry) to avoid associating the bed with wakefulness.
Melatonin is a chronobiotic, not a direct sedative; it helps reset the body clock and should be taken 10-12 hours before desired wake-up time, not at bedtime.
Over-the-counter sleep aids (like antihistamines) provide sedation, not natural, restorative sleep, often disrupting crucial REM sleep and leading to grogginess.
Small, consistent changes in routine and mindset can lead to significant improvements in sleep quality and overall executive functioning for individuals with ADHD.

Complete Darkness: Bedrooms should be completely dark to facilitate continuous melatonin secretion throughout the night.
Darkness Test [7:06]: Hold your hand at arm's length in your dark bedroom; if you can see it, there's too much light.
Blackout Eye Masks [7:18]: Contoured eye masks are recommended as they don't irritate eyelashes and provide minimal contact around the eyes, addressing sensory sensitivities common in ADHD.
3. Cognitive Behavioral Therapy for Insomnia (CBT-I) [8:14]
CBT-I is recognized as the "gold standard" and preferred first-line treatment for chronic insomnia, especially effective for people with ADHD.
This involves challenging and changing maladaptive beliefs about sleep (e.g., "I am a bad sleeper," "a bad night's sleep will ruin my next day").
Being realistic that one bad night doesn't guarantee a terrible next day helps reduce anticipatory anxiety.
The Problem with Sleep Trackers (Orthosomnia) [9:30]
Wearable sleep trackers, like smartwatches, often provide inaccurate data on sleep stages (e.g., REM sleep).
This inaccurate data can lead to "orthosomnia," where individuals become overly anxious about their sleep performance based on device readings, exacerbating anxiety and actually hindering sleep.
If you find yourself awake in bed for more than 20 minutes, get out of bed for at least 20 minutes.
Engage in a "Boring" Activity [11:40]: Choose something non-stimulating and slightly tedious (e.g., folding laundry, reading a dry textbook) in a dimly lit room.
Avoid Over-Stimulation: Do not turn on bright lights, engage with screens, or do anything overly engaging that makes it difficult to "task switch" back to sleep.
This practice helps to re-associate your bed with sleep and prevents the bed from becoming a source of frustration.
Over-the-counter sleep aids (e.g., Unisom, Benadryl, Gravol) or even prescribed medications are generally not recommended for long-term use.
These provide sedation, not natural sleep.
They disrupt crucial REM sleep (rapid eye movement sleep), which is vital for mood regulation and executive functions, leading to grogginess and a "hungover" feeling upon waking.
These medications are intended for short-term, situational use only (e.g., 7-10 days).
